Plus the ones they get confused with." url: https://atoneplace.net/font/display/ site: "At One Place" --- # Display typefaces 4 display typefaces, oldest first. | Typeface | Year | Designer | What it signals now | | --- | --- | --- | --- | | Cooper Black | 1922 | Oswald Bruce Cooper | The 1970s, unmistakably. Soft, heavy, friendly, slightly stoned. | | Impact | 1965 | Geoffrey Lee | An image macro. Nothing else, any more. | | Papyrus | 1982 | Chris Costello | A smoothie bar, a yoga studio, or Avatar. | | Comic Sans | 1994 | Vincent Connare | A hospital notice, a village hall poster, or a joke about typography. | - [Cooper Black](https://atoneplace.net/font/cooper-black/) — Oswald Bruce Cooper, 1922 - [Impact](https://atoneplace.net/font/impact/) — Geoffrey Lee, 1965 - [Papyrus](https://atoneplace.net/font/papyrus/) — Chris Costello, 1982 - [Comic Sans](https://atoneplace.net/font/comic-sans/) — Vincent Connare, 1994 ## Related pages - [Serif typefaces](https://atoneplace.net/font/serif/) - [Sans-serif typefaces](https://atoneplace.net/font/sans/) - [Slab serif typefaces](https://atoneplace.net/font/slab/) - [Monospace typefaces](https://atoneplace.net/font/monospace/)
